Sumario: | Hadronic event shapes are studied with a data sample of 7~TeV proton-proton collisions collected with the CMS detector at the Large Hadron Collider (LHC). The size of the sample corresponds to an integrated luminosity of~78\,nb${}^{-1}$.
Jets constructed with different techniques are used as input for calculating event-shape variables, which probe the structure of the hadronic final state. Normalized event-shape distributions are shown to be robust against various sources of systematic uncertainty. It is demonstrated that these early measurements of event-shape variables are sensitive to differences in the modeling of QCD multi-jet production. |
